Page MenuHomePhabricator

Some DjVu files do not display within Commons while others do
Closed, ResolvedPublic

Description

While the implementation of the DjVu viewer on Commons is a good thing in the
first place, it doesn't really work well. This is how it should work:

http://commons.wikimedia.org/wiki/Image:Thekla_Schneider_Irmentrud.djvu

http://commons.wikimedia.org/wiki/Image:Rambaldi_Der_Welfen_Wiege.djvu

And this is how other DjVus are not displayed correctly:

http://commons.wikimedia.org/wiki/Image:Scharff_Reformation_Isny.djvu

http://commons.wikimedia.org/wiki/Image:Juliana_Ernstin_Chronik_Villingen.djvu

http://commons.wikimedia.org/wiki/Image:Die_alte_Rauenspurc.djvu

These three files were compiled with the same software, and the actual stored
files are perfectly fine when viewed with the browser plugin. But they cannot be
viewed correctly within Commons, since the graphics just don't show up.

Another user has the same problem with the same files, in Firefox 1.5 and IE 6.0
(as discussed at
http://commons.wikimedia.org/wiki/Commons:Village_pump#DjVu_files ), and since I
could not find any documentation at all about DjVu and Commons (not how it's
supposed to works, no FAQ as to preferable file sizes or file names, none
whatsoever), I am posting it here.


Version: unspecified
Severity: normal
OS: Windows XP
Platform: PC
URL: http://commons.wikimedia.org/wiki/Image:Die_alte_Rauenspurc.djvu

Details

Reference
bz9327

Event Timeline

bzimport raised the priority of this task from to Medium.Nov 21 2014, 9:40 PM
bzimport set Reference to bz9327.
bzimport added a subscriber: Unknown Object (MLST).

Fixed, as per my workaround on the upstream issue:

https://sourceforge.net/tracker/?func=detail&atid=406583&aid=1704049&group_id=32953

Try action=purge on the image description page before reopening or re-reporting
this bug.

snottygobble wrote:

Reopening. In the past two weeks I have come across numerous examples of DjVu files for which MediaWiki is failing to display at least ''some'' pages. Purging doesn't solve the problem, nor does waiting a while.

On Commons, affected files include

  • [[Commons:File:Studies in the Scriptures - Series I - The Plan of the Ages (1909).djvu]]
  • [[Commons:File:Speeches And Writings MKGandhi.djvu]]
  • [[Commons:File:Post-Mediaeval Preachers.djvu]]
  • [[Commons:File:JPS1917-The Writings.djvu
  • [[Commons:File:Armistice Day.djvu
  • [[Commons:File:A complete index volumes 1-25 of Poet Lore.djvu

On the English Wikisource, affected files include:

  • [[en:Wikisource:File:Romain Rolland Handel.djvu]]
  • [[en:Wikisource:File:Oxford Book of English Verse 1250-1918.djvu

snottygobble wrote:

Latest example is

  • [[Commons:File:Voyage in search of La Perouse (Stockdale).djvu]]

Purging doesn't fix this. Nor does re-uploading.

This bug is blocking several transcription projects on Wikisource. A workaround or solutions would be much appreciated.

thomasV1 wrote:

This comes from invalid UTF8 returned by djvutxt when parsing the djvu text layer.
It should be fixed in revision 55768.